The Dawn of Reasoning-Based AI
On September 12, 2024, OpenAI officially unveiled ‘o1’, its newest model series designed specifically for complex reasoning. Unlike previous iterations of GPT models that provide near-instantaneous responses, o1 utilizes a chain-of-thought process, allowing it to evaluate steps, troubleshoot errors, and refine its logic before delivering an output. This development is not just an incremental improvement; it is a fundamental shift in how large language models (LLMs) approach professional-grade tasks.
Empowering Industrial Workflows
According to official statements from OpenAI, the o1 model shows significant advancements in solving sophisticated problems in physics, chemistry, and high-level coding. For businesses, this means that intelligent systems are no longer limited to drafting emails or summarizing documents. They are becoming architects of complex solutions. Whether it is optimizing global supply chains, debugging intricate software architectures, or conducting scientific research, the ability of these models to reason provides a competitive edge for companies aiming for operational excellence.
